  • I have been involved with natural science, in one way or another, for over three decades. However, my journey into holistic nutrition came about in 1990 when I came across the work of biochemist John Bogden, PhD., Univ. of Medicine and Dentistry of New Jersey. Studying the nutritional status of HIV+ individuals, he reported that 6 of the 21 nutrients he marked were significantly below normal in 25% of his participants. This interested me and as I studied the deficient nutrients I began to realize the vital role they play in our health, not only in immune system function, but throughout the body.  This was a time when the dangers of Aquired Immune Deficiency Syndrome (AIDs) were emerging. Much was accomplished using foundations of Holistic Nutrition and I found myself working with people living with HIV/AIDS, seniors, women and the mentally challenged, I became more politically pro-active, I began to help those in need develop sensible approaches to improving their health in addition to study and broadcasting the emerging information about pioneering advances in understanding nutrition. Contributing to the efforts of the Nutritional Health Alliance, I participated in the passing of the Dietary Supplement Health and Education Act (DSHEA) in 1994. I testified before the White House Commission on CAM Policy and the committee on Health & Human Services, Washington, D.C., about the right of citizens to know the benefits of natural therapies and the right for Naturopathy to offer it to them. Several points regarding standards and ethics were adopted in their final report.
